Output eecf192d25a25cd2de81b03421f59121babd27c81c0e5df7c8aa766759461be0:34

value
135533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538f5720caa90822e7e4ba0d3712bfb287ef488c OP_EQUAL
address
39JqivjzHsAXbZZXn3A7PA23WZtPajDGDM
transaction
eecf192d25a25cd2de81b03421f59121babd27c81c0e5df7c8aa766759461be0